Boc-N-Me-D-Ser-OMe

Description:
Boc-N-Me-D-Ser-OMe, with the CAS number 220903-92-4, is a chemical compound that belongs to the class of amino acid derivatives. It features a protected serine residue, where the amino group is tert-butyloxycarbonyl (Boc) protected, and the hydroxyl group is methylated (OMe). This compound is characterized by its chirality, as it contains a D-serine configuration, which is significant in various biochemical applications. The presence of the methyl group on the nitrogen (N-Me) enhances its stability and solubility in organic solvents. Boc-N-Me-D-Ser-OMe is often utilized in peptide synthesis and medicinal chemistry, serving as a building block for more complex molecules. Its protective groups allow for selective reactions, making it a valuable intermediate in the synthesis of bioactive compounds. Additionally, the compound's properties, such as melting point, solubility, and reactivity, can vary based on the specific conditions under which it is handled. Overall, Boc-N-Me-D-Ser-OMe is an important compound in the field of organic and medicinal chemistry.
Formula:C10H19NO5
InChI:InChI=1S/C10H19NO5/c1-10(2,3)16-9(14)11(4)7(6-12)8(13)15-5/h7,12H,6H2,1-5H3/t7-/m1/s1
InChI key:LUHJSLLCWQRODJ-SSDOTTSWSA-N
SMILES:CC(C)(C)OC(=O)N(C)[C@H](CO)C(=O)OC
Synonyms:
  • D-Serine, N-[(1,1-dimethylethoxy)carbonyl]-N-methyl-, methyl ester
  • Boc-N-Me-D-Ser-OMe
  • BOC-N-METHYL-D-SERINE METHYL ESTER
